Rebecca is a Hydro DPS built around durable summons and scaling burst damage. Her kit revolves around placing jellyfish-like allies that inherit her stats, stacking a transferable damage-over-time effect on enemies, and cashing those stacks in with a hard-hitting ultimate. The result is a lane-clearing, low-maintenance playstyle that also shreds bosses when timed correctly.
Rebecca’s role and core kit (what makes her strong)
Element and role: Hydro DPS focused on Skill DMG and summons.
Weapons: Polearm (melee) and Grenade Launcher (ranged).
Summon skill: Calls an Aurelia Aurita that persists for about 14 seconds and inherits 100% of her stats, dealing continuous Hydro damage. Up to 3 can be active by default.
Passive stacks: Melee hits and summon ticks apply Poison of Love stacks (up to 6). The effect deals periodic Hydro damage and transfers to nearby enemies when a target dies.
Ultimate: Lada Lovedew deals area Hydro damage that scales upward based on the current Poison of Love stack count on enemies.
This loop is straightforward: maintain three summons, keep stacks rolling via melee taps or summon ticks, then detonate with the ultimate when stacks are high. As a Combat Partner, Rebecca also provides a notable ally buff: Seven-Day Spread increases ATK for herself and nearby Hydro teammates (listed at +50%).

Tolerance guidance: This arrangement sits around 108/100 Tolerance. With Ignite, the maximum can exceed the usual cap to roughly 110.5, giving you room to slot in stronger pieces without breaking the limit.

Rotation: Place/refresh summons → tap melee to accelerate stacks as needed → cast Lada Lovedew when stacks are near cap or when many enemies are affected.
Combat Partner note: Seven-Day Spread provides a sizable ATK boost for Hydro lineups (+50%).

Rebecca’s core stats trend as follows: ATK grows from 25 to about 470.71; HP and Shield from 100 to about 1255; Max Sanity is listed at 150. Skill Range increases with level (to roughly 130%).

Practical rotation and setup notes
Pre-fight: Ensure Demon Wedges emphasize ATK%, Skill DMG, and Hydro DMG. Guixu Ratchet’s high Critical Damage naturally complements this setup.
In combat: Place or refresh summons until you have three active. Use short melee strings to accelerate Poison of Love stacks without overcommitting.
Burst window: Cast Lada Lovedew when stacks are near their cap or when multiple enemies carry stacks to maximize the bonus scaling.
Uptime: With introns unlocked, especially Intron 2, the build leans even harder into summon pressure and higher stack ceilings.
If you’re starting fresh, the free Rebecca-led F2P team will comfortably carry early story and farming tasks. As resources tighten, prioritize raising Aurelian Caress and Lada Lovedew first, then round out passive levels and wedges that boost ATK%, Skill DMG, and Hydro DMG. From there, a Grenade Launcher like Guixu Ratchet and the Ignite-cored Wedge layout will keep her performing at a high level across both mobbing and bosses.
